From b1d84514f010aa3de32fda204207dec33c6f7a8c Mon Sep 17 00:00:00 2001 From: Tuncer Ayaz Date: Mon, 12 Dec 2011 17:14:24 +0100 Subject: [PATCH] Add rebar_utils:deprecated/4 and remove define --- include/rebar.hrl | 3 --- src/rebar_utils.erl | 17 ++++++++++------- 2 files changed, 10 insertions(+), 10 deletions(-) diff --git a/include/rebar.hrl b/include/rebar.hrl index a6534e1..0f4e90f 100644 --- a/include/rebar.hrl +++ b/include/rebar.hrl @@ -10,6 +10,3 @@ -define(ERROR(Str, Args), rebar_log:log(error, Str, Args)). -define(FMT(Str, Args), lists:flatten(io_lib:format(Str, Args))). - --define(DEPRECATED(Key, Old, New, Opts, When), - rebar_utils:deprecated(Key, Old, New, Opts, When)). diff --git a/src/rebar_utils.erl b/src/rebar_utils.erl index ddd5ddc..0265f45 100644 --- a/src/rebar_utils.erl +++ b/src/rebar_utils.erl @@ -42,7 +42,7 @@ find_executable/1, prop_check/3, expand_code_path/0, - deprecated/5, + deprecated/4, deprecated/5, expand_env_variable/3, is_skipped_app/0 ]). @@ -326,12 +326,15 @@ emulate_escript_foldl(Fun, Acc, File) -> deprecated(Key, Old, New, Opts, When) -> case lists:member(Old, Opts) of true -> - io:format( - <<"WARNING: deprecated ~p option used~n" - "Option '~p' has been deprecated~n" - "in favor of '~p'.~n" - "'~p' will be removed ~s.~n~n">>, - [Key, Old, New, Old, When]); + deprecated(Key, Old, New, When); false -> ok end. + +deprecated(Key, Old, New, When) -> + io:format( + <<"WARNING: deprecated ~p option used~n" + "Option '~p' has been deprecated~n" + "in favor of '~p'.~n" + "'~p' will be removed ~s.~n~n">>, + [Key, Old, New, Old, When]).